Spot Welders is a renowned creative agency based in the vibrant city of New York, NY. With a diverse portfolio and a team of talented professionals, they offer a range of innovative services to meet their clients' needs.
Specializing in various creative disciplines, Spot Welders provides cutting-edge solutions for businesses seeking to enhance their brand presence and engage with their target audience effectively.
Generated from the website